    UConn vs Duke Final Four Buzzer Beater Sends Huskies to the Promised Land

    0
    By UStorie News Desk on March 30, 2026 Sports

    The NCAA tournament has delivered its most iconic moment yet. In a game that will be talked about for decades, the UConn vs Duke Final Four buzzer beater has officially punched the Huskies’ ticket to the national semifinals. In a heart-stopping finish that saw the lead change three times in the final thirty seconds, UConn executed a perfect out-of-bounds play to sink the Blue Devils at the horn, leaving the Duke faithful in stunned silence.

    For UConn, this victory is a testament to their championship DNA and their ability to remain calm under the most intense pressure. For Duke, it is a haunting “what if,” as they surrendered a late lead in a game they seemingly had under control. As the dust settles on the Elite Eight, the college basketball world is reeling from a weekend of high-stakes drama and massive shifts in the national landscape.

    The Shot Heard ‘Round the Tournament

    With only 1.2 seconds remaining on the clock and Duke leading by one point, UConn drew up a sideline out-of-bounds play that utilized a double-screen to free up their leading scorer at the top of the key. The catch-and-shoot motion was fluid, and the ball rattled home just as the red lights flashed around the backboard. It was the kind of “One Shining Moment” that defines March Madness.

    According to the USA Today analysis of the UConn vs Duke thriller, the tactical breakdown of Duke’s defense in the final seconds will be scrutinized for years. The Blue Devils opted not to pressure the inbounder, allowing a clean pass that set the game-winning sequence in motion.

    Duke’s Collapse: A High-Stakes Heartbreak

    While UConn celebrates, the narrative in Durham will be one of missed opportunities. Duke led by as many as nine points midway through the second half, but a series of uncharacteristic turnovers and missed free throws allowed the Huskies to hang around. The “Blue Devils blow it” headline is already circulating among critics who question the team’s late-game composure.
